html - 是否可以在不刷新页面的情况下将数据从 node.js express 发送到前端 html?
问题描述
现在我有一个页面显示所有带有可折叠手风琴的会议。一开始所有的会议都被瓦解了。然后,当我单击会议按钮(在屏幕截图中命名为“音频”)时,包含会议 ID 的请求被发送到 node.js express 并从数据库中检索会议详细信息并通过 express 返回到相同的html页面。要显示会议详细信息,将显示先前折叠的面板。
以下是折叠会议的屏幕截图。前两列用于会议代码和会议名称。
所以基本上它是通过路由从前端调用 express,并且从 express 只返回数据而不是完整的 html,并且 html 的 js 文件将处理这些数据并将它们显示在面板中。
node.js express有没有什么办法可以只向前端html发送数据而不刷新页面?
解决方案
有一种可能,是的,通过 AJAX,您只需将 ajax 与 node (express) 一起应用。当您执行前后 ajax 时,它会在不重新加载页面的情况下返回数据字体:
https://www.w3schools.com/xml/ajax_intro.asp
https://pt.wikipedia.org/wiki/AJAX_(programa%C3%A7%C3%A3o)
推荐阅读
- powershell - 从 powershell 向 cmd 传递命令
- selenium-webdriver - 未使用 xpath 选中复选框,它会打开链接
- rest - Magento 1.* rest API php oauth 身份验证
- python - Unicode 编码错误 'latin-1' 编解码器无法在位置 4939 对字符 u'\u2013' 进行编码:序数不在范围内(256)
- reactjs - 如何在 TypeScript 中获取 GraphQL 架构
- php - 如果密码验证条件中的条件在 php 中无法正常工作
- php - MySQL 上的 SELECT 不适用于我的 PHP 脚本,但适用于 phpmyadmin
- xamarin - Xamarin Java 库绑定问题
- excel - Excel VBA 编辑注释(如果存在)
- javascript - 结合单选按钮和文本字段